Question
Show graphically that the system of equations x – 4y + 14 = 0; 3x + 2y – 14 = 0 is consistent with unique solution.

Solution
The given system of equations is
x – 4y + 14 = 0 ….(1)
3x + 2y – 14 = 0 ….(2)
`x – 4y + 14 = 0 ⇒ y = \frac { x + 14 }{ 4 }`
| x | 6 | -2 |
| y | 5 | 3 |
| Points | A | B |
`3x + 2y – 14 = 0 ⇒ y = \frac { -3x + 14 }{ 2 }`
| x | 0 | 4 |
| y | 7 | 1 |
| Points | C | D |

The given equations representing two lines, intersect each other at a unique point (2, 4). Hence, the equations are consistent with unique solution.
